Death Rock


  Time is forever decaded to wait,
    a never ending story in a never ending date.
      Spending eternity wondering the outcome of Fate,
        never realizing it until Death hits your plate.

  Time is a measurement used so life goes on,
    it is what embraces every new days dawn.
      Born on a clock, a stop watch life spawn.
        before you know the hourglasses sand is gone.

  When your body gives in you'll finally meet Death's Rock,
    There's no way for a restart, an indestructible time clock.
      Everyday it is our own life we choose to mock,
        One more lethal shock as you walk to Deaths Rock...
